摘 要:伴随着铁路货车大幅度提速、重载运输的快速发展,对货车安全管理、运用、检修业务提出了更高水平的要求。当前迫切需要通过对TPDS系统监测数据开展深入挖掘和规律分析工作,更加及时、有效地提供货车运行技术状态信息,为货车故障诊断与预测、货车检修提供辅助决策支撑。目前铁路车辆部门对TPDS系统历史监测数据深入挖掘研究和应用尚处于起步阶段,数据价值未最大化发挥,传统的计算技术和TPDS系统自身的处理能力已无法适应业务数据爆炸式的增长需要。当前Web服务、云计算、大数据等新一代计算机技术不断发展,并在社会各行各业都有了深入的应用,大数据技术的成功应用为TPDS系统检测数据深入挖掘提供了重要经验借鉴。Along with the rapid development of railway wagons and heavy-haul transportation, higher levels of requirements have been imposed on the safety management, operation, and maintenance of trucks. At present, it is urgent to carry out in-depth mining and regular analysis of the monitoring data of the TPDS system to provide timely and effective information on the technical status of truck operation, the in-depth research and application of historical monitoring data of the TPDS system by the railway vehicle department is still in its infancy, and the value of data has not been maximized. Traditional computing technology and the processing capacity of the TPDS system itself cannot meet the explosive growth of business data. At present, the new generation of computer technologies such as Web services, cloud computing, and big data are constantly developing, and have been deeply applied in all walks of life in society. The successful application of big data technologies has provided important lessons for in-depth mining of TPDS system inspection data.
